Quinnipiac Bobcats Preview


Quinnipiac Bobcats have a 10-5 record this season and are in 3rd place in the MAAC. They have a 6-1 home record and are coming off an 80-79 away loss against Manhattan. Their previous three games were a 64-58 home win against Marist, a 74-66 away loss against Hofstra and an 85-75 away win against Monmouth.

Offensively, Quinnipiac averages 77.8 points per game, while allowing 72.9 points per game defensively. The Bobcats shoot with 44% from the field and grab 37 rebounds per game, while dishing out 14.1 assists per game. They average 5.2 blocks per game and 9.3 steals per game defensively.

Amarri Monroe leads Quinnipiac in scoring, with an average of 15 points per game, while shooting with 43.9% from the field and 78.4% from the free throw line. Amarri Monroe is also the team’s leading rebounder with 7.1 per game, while Asim Jones adds a team-high 4.2 assists per game.

Mount St. Mary’s Mountaineers Preview


Mount St. Mary’s Mountaineers have a 5-10 record this season and are tied for 10th place in the MAAC. They have a 2-7 away record and are coming off a 75-65 away loss against Merrimack. Their previous three games were a 66-59 home win against Iona, a 73-42 home win against Penn State Brandywine and a 75-67 away loss against Drexel.

Offensively, Mount St. Mary’s averages 68.1 points per game, while allowing 74.8 points per game defensively. The Mountaineers shoot with 44% from the field and grab 36.1 rebounds per game, while dishing out 14.9 assists per game. They average 2.9 blocks per game and 6.2 steals per game defensively.

Trey Deveaux leads Mount St. Mary’s in scoring, with an average of 11.8 points per game, while shooting with 44.7% from the field and 62.2% from the free throw line. Luke McEldon is the team’s leading rebounder with 5.8 per game, while Xavier Lipscomb adds a team-high 4.1 assists per game.

Mount St. Mary’s vs Quinnipiac Prediction


In this Mount St. Mary’s vs Quinnipiac Prediction, Quinnipiac is coming as -10 home favorites. Quinnipiac has been the better team this season as they have twice as many overall wins than Mount St. Mary’s and have been almost perfect at home, while Mount St. Mary’s has been terrible on the road. But they are 1-2 in their last 3 games, while Mount St. Mary’s is 3-1 in its last 4 so I see no value on either side. Both teams have been involved in some lower-scoring games lately, going for 10-2 to the under in their last 12 games combined, so I expect another low-scoring affair between two struggling offenses. Take the under 150.5 points.
